What’s proposed

RETENTION & PLANNING: Planning Permission for development at 155 Parnell Street, Dublin 1, an existing mid-terrace 4 storey over basement building fronting onto Parnell Street and Parnell Place. The planning application consists of application for retention of a 35sqm single storey ground floor extension to the rear of the building, retention of roof covering over the smoking area at ground floor facing onto Parnell Lane and the retention of a 2.1m high wooden boundary fence at first floor level separating 155 and 156 Parnell Street. The development also consists of planning permission for the use of the flat roof at 1st floor level to the rear of the building as a terrace of approximately 74sqm accessed via an external stairs from the smoking terrace together with all associated landscaping and site works
